The photo was taken at Luzern in Switzerland last month. At the center there is the most famous sight in Luzern called Kapellbrucke mit Wasserturm. The baroque style building at the right side is the Jesuitenkirche Church.

A good try for a newbie. This is something different from the angle; usually most of the time people would take from the other end of the Kapellbrucke but I guess what attracted you to try is probably the blue sky. However from a technical stand-point your photo is kind of heavy on the right and with the building looking tilted it seems even more imbalanced. Should try to improve on your framing. I think you are also trying to cram too many things into the photo; I think you probably have better results if you "zoom-in" into specific part of your view and not have too many subjects. For such a view if you really want to take a landscape to show the expanded view, you'll probably have it better if you don't use too wide an angle and do panoramic shots of the area (join them up by software); this way you can cover more area which I think is better for you because on the left side I believe were some nice looking buildings too if I remember correctly particularly on those with unique widows a-la a nun headress. Good try anyway. I'm sure you'll improve eventually.
